Larry Wapnitsky's thoughts:
This was a well-organized race designed to raise money in the name of a little girl who left us way too early.
The course was very nice, some decent hills, and a quick trip through the Ambler campus of Temple University. Unfortunately, the course wound up being short by at least half a mile. Although Run The Day is usually good about updating information on a race when its been found to be invalid, they still (to this day) have not updated the course distance, showing me with a significantly faster pace than I actually ran.
Added on the the race is a nice family carnival that will be expanding in 2018. I'm definitely up for doing this race again, and hope that the RD marks the course appropriately for this year.
